Kyle Eastwood, Tom Scott And Michael Paulo Celebrating Birthdays
Musicians Kyle Eastwood, Tom Scott and Michael Paulo are all celebrating their birthdays today (May 19).
Eastwood is 42. In 2006, he released Now, which featured the smooth jazz single of the same name. Eastwood grew up in Carmel, CA, as the son of legendary actor and American icon Clint Eastwood, who himself is a huge jazz fan. In addition to his albums – including his latest, Metropolitan – Eastwood has composed music for movies directed by his father, including Mystic River, Million Dollar Baby, Flags of Our Fathers, The Changeling and Letters from Iwo Jima.
Grammy Award-winning saxophonist Scott, known for his work with the L.A. Express, is 62. He grew up in a musical family where his father, Nathan Scott, wrote music for classic TV shows. Scott also has written music for TV as well, including such shows as Family Ties, Baretta and Starsky and Hutch. Today, Scott has released more than 25 solo albums and has logged more than 500 dates as a session saxophonist for many popular artists such as Paul McCartney, Whitney Houston, Michael Jackson and Steely Dan.
Saxophonist Paulo, who recorded four CDs with the Hawaiian band Kalapana before moving to Los Angeles in 1981 to pursue a solo career, is 54. He has since performed with a long list of artists, including Peter White, Al Jarreau, Rick Braun, Kenny Loggins, Jeff Lorber and Bobby Caldwell. Paulo lives in Southern California’s Riverside County and has released six solo CDs.
